Connect QuickBooks to Claude: Close Your Books 4x Faster
By CorpusIQ Team
Month-end close is the most avoidable time sink in a small business. A controller spends 12-18 hours copying numbers from QuickBooks into Google Sheets, chasing down expense categorizations in email, and reconciling what the P&L says against what the operator thinks happened. Most of that work is translation, not analysis.
Connecting QuickBooks to Claude through CorpusIQ cuts the translation work to zero. You ask a question in plain English, Claude pulls the data from QuickBooks in real time, and you get the answer in seconds. The numbers come from Intuit, not from a copy-paste.
The problem with the current workflow
The standard month-end close looks something like this. Open QuickBooks, run the P&L, export to CSV, clean the CSV in Sheets, add variance columns, build a summary tab, paste into a Slack thread for the team. Run the AR aging, email the top five overdue customers. Pull cash position, compare to last month, flag anything outside the normal range. Repeat every month.
None of this is hard. All of it is slow. The finance lead becomes a data mover instead of a decision maker. When the CEO asks a follow-up question that requires slicing the data differently, the whole process starts over.
The deeper issue is that questions die before they get asked. If pulling a custom slice of the P&L takes 20 minutes, you only ask the big questions. The small questions, the ones that actually surface problems early, never get answered because the friction is too high.
How CorpusIQ solves it
CorpusIQ exposes QuickBooks Online to Claude through the Model Context Protocol. MCP is an open standard that lets AI assistants call external tools in a structured way. When you connect QuickBooks via CorpusIQ, Claude gets a set of tools it can use to pull P&L, balance sheet, AR aging, AP aging, invoices, payments, vendors, and customer records directly from your books.
Three things make this different from generic QuickBooks reporting:
The connection is read-only. CorpusIQ uses OAuth with read-only scopes. Claude can query your books, but it cannot create, modify, or delete anything. There is no scenario where an AI typo becomes a miscategorized transaction.
No data is stored. CorpusIQ does not copy your QuickBooks data into a warehouse, a cache, or a training set. When Claude asks a question, CorpusIQ fetches the answer from Intuit in real time and returns it. Close your browser and the data is gone from CorpusIQ.
Access is revocable in one click. Disconnect CorpusIQ from QuickBooks at any time from the Intuit admin panel or the CorpusIQ dashboard. The OAuth token is invalidated immediately.
What you can actually do
Once QuickBooks is connected, these are real prompts you can paste into Claude. Each pulls live data from your books.
- "What is my cash position today versus 30 days ago, and what drove the difference?"
- "Show me overdue invoices sorted by age, grouped by customer."
- "Which expense categories are up more than 20 percent month over month?"
- "List every customer with an open balance over $5,000 and their payment history for the last 6 months."
- "Give me a profit and loss for Q1, then compare it to Q1 last year."
- "Which vendors have we paid the most this quarter, and which ones are on net 30 terms?"
- "Flag any transactions over $2,000 that look miscategorized based on the vendor name."
- "What is my average days-to-pay across customers, and which 5 customers are pulling the average up?"
These are not canned reports. Claude constructs the answer from the underlying data, so follow-up questions work naturally. Ask for a P&L, then ask why marketing is up, then ask which specific line items drove it. Three questions, three seconds each.
Setup in 3 minutes
Connecting QuickBooks to Claude through CorpusIQ is a standard OAuth flow.
- Create an account at corpusiq.io. The Solo plan at $29.95/month includes QuickBooks plus all 25+ connectors, with a 30-day free trial.
- From the CorpusIQ dashboard, click Connect next to QuickBooks Online. You will be redirected to Intuit to approve read-only access.
- In Claude, add the CorpusIQ MCP server to your integrations. Full instructions are in the CorpusIQ dashboard under Setup.
That is it. Open Claude and ask your first question. No CSV export, no pivot table, no copy-paste.
Where this pays off most
The operators who get the biggest lift from this setup are the ones with a small finance function and a lot of month-end questions. One-person finance teams, founder-operators doing their own books, and fractional CFOs supporting multiple clients all benefit because the ratio of questions to headcount is high.
It also works well for audit prep. Instead of pulling ten custom reports before a review, you connect QuickBooks to Claude and let the reviewer ask questions directly. The answers come from the source. No one is wondering whether the spreadsheet was up to date.
What to watch out for
Two honest caveats.
First, Claude is not a replacement for a controller or a CPA. It answers questions about the data that exists in QuickBooks. If your books are miscategorized, the answers will be wrong in the same way the books are wrong. Fix the books first, then ask better questions.
Second, the tool is only as useful as the questions you ask. Teams that have never thought about AR aging by cohort will not suddenly start. The benefit shows up when you already have a reporting habit and want to stop spending an afternoon to feed it.
See also
FAQ
Does CorpusIQ store my QuickBooks data?
No. CorpusIQ uses read-only OAuth and passes data through without storage. Your books never leave Intuit.
What plan do I need?
Solo at $29.95/mo includes QuickBooks and all 25+ connectors.
Can Claude write back to QuickBooks?
No. CorpusIQ is read-only by design. Claude can answer questions but cannot create invoices, modify transactions, or change your books.
Does this work with QuickBooks Desktop?
Only QuickBooks Online. Desktop does not expose the API CorpusIQ requires.